California Child Care: CPR and First Aid
This 8 hour course teaches individuals to respond to breathing and cardiac emergencies, pediatric first aid and injury prevention. This class meets CA EMSA requirements of daycare providers.
Certification
Upon successful completion, students will receive an Adult, Infant, Child CPR certificate valid for 1 year and a CA Child Care First Aid certificate valid for 2 years.
California Child Care: Health & Safety
This 7 hour course provides training for daycare providers about preventing infectious diseases, caring for ill children and checking for immunizations in the child care setting. Fee includes the State approved sticker.
Certification
Upon successful completion, students will receive a California Child Care Health & Safety certificate valid indefinitely.
